Superior safety: the electrochemical performance of sodium-ion batteries is relatively stable and safer in use than lithium-ion batteries. Additionally, sodium batteries can operate normally in the temperature range from -40C to 80C, and the capacity retention rate is close to 90% in a -20C environment, with performance better than other lithium batteries that lose half their charge and lead batteries that are only a quarter at 100-200A (1240-2480-4960W). Model 24.8V 100-200 Ah
Nominal voltage 24.8 V
Nominal capacity 100-200 Ah @ 50-100A
Nominal energy 2480-4960 Wh
Standard charging voltage 31.6V 0.2V (27 Min-31 V Max.)
Minimum discharge voltage 16.0-19 V
Maximum allowable charging current 300-600 A
Maximum discharge current 300-600 A
Peak discharge current @10S 1000-2000A
Peak discharge current @3S 2100-4200A
CCA about 1000-2000A
Temperature Charging temperature: -40C- +50C / Discharge temperature -40C- +70C Ignition duration > 50,000 starts 3000cycles,60% DOD
Weight 28-50kg 520*269*220mm
